The receptors for steroid hormones are located inside the cell,instead of on the membrane surface like most other signal receptors.Why is this not a problem for steroids?


A) because the receptors can be readily stimulated to exit and relocate on the membrane surface
B) because receptors located inside cells are less susceptible to blockage by inhibitors located on or near the cell surface,so it serves as a protective mechanism
C) because steroid hormones are lipid soluble so can readily diffuse through the lipid bilayer of the cell membrane
D) because the receptors are repressible,meaning they are actively altering cell function unless the target hormone is present
